-White Charcoal, also known as Binchotan, is a type of hardwood charcoal that has traditionally been produced in Japan. It is called White charcoal because of its light color and unique benefits that create economic value compared to traditional black charcoal. -Binchotan is the purest charcoal on earth by the highest carbon proportion (more than 92%) and is completely odorless, and smokeless when burning. White Charcoal is more difficult to ignite than black charcoal; however, it burns hotter and longer. When hitting the pieces together, it gives a light metallic sound. The white charcoal doesnot break into small pieces while burning. USAGES Food grilled over white charcoal retains its natural flavor and moisture because it burns cleanly and without flames. It is popular in high-end restaurants and mostly in Korea and Japan. In addition, binchotan has many uses such as water purification, exhaust filter, deodorant, skin care, metallurgy, used in battery manufacture...

Shisha charcoal, specifically hardwood charcoal, is a premium fuel source used for heating tobacco in shisha or hookah smoking. Made from dense hardwood, this type of charcoal is favored for its ability to produce a consistent and long-lasting heat without the chemical additives found in many briquettes. Hardwood charcoal burns hotter and cleaner, enhancing the flavor of the shisha while minimizing unpleasant odors or tastes. Its natural composition allows for an authentic smoking experience, providing smooth, flavorful puffs that complement the various fruit and spice blends of the tobacco. Additionally, hardwood charcoal is often available in various shapes, including cubes and disks, making it versatile for different types of shisha setups. The use of hardwood charcoal not only improves the quality of the smoking experience but also aligns with eco-friendly practices, as it is a renewable resource.

Our Hookah Shisha charcoal is produced from Coconut shell. Coconut shell charcoal is the most preferred for hookah shisha because of its uniform burn, low ash, high temperature, no odour and long burn time. Our factory is based in the coconut cultivating hub of South India where there is plenty of coconut shells available. The process that we follow is : Collection of coconut shells from farmers, segregation and cleaning. Carbonizing the coconut shells using our carbonization reactor. (Conversion to high grade coconut shell charcoal) 1. Pulverizing the coconut shell charcoal into fine powder 2. Mixing with a natural starch (we use cassava starch) 3. Forming into cubes (we produce both pressed cubes and extruded cubes) ArSta eco Hookah Shisha charcoal cubes comes with the following specifications : Moisture: max 5% Ash content: max 5% Volatile: max 12% Fixed carbon: min 78% Gross calorific value: min 7200 kcal/kg Ignition time: max 10 minutes over gas stove Time of burn: min 90 minutes Dimensions : Cube 2.5cms * 2.5cms * 2.5cms We can also produce to other specifications as required by clients.
